Forecast: Import of Lamp and Lighting Fitting Parts of Glass to Japan

The import of lamp and lighting fitting parts of glass to Japan is expected to decline consistently from 2024 to 2028. This trend is illustrated by a steady decrease in volume from 915.56 thousand kilograms in 2024 to 702.0 thousand kilograms in 2028. Compared to 2023, the downward trend underscores a declining interest or need for these imports. An analysis of year-on-year variations reveals a consistent decrease of around 6% to 7% annually over the forecast period.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) over these five years suggests a declining trajectory.

Future trends to watch include advancements in LED and smart lighting technology, which could further reduce demand for traditional glass lamp fittings. Additionally, shifts in energy efficiency regulations and sustainability initiatives in Japan may impact import levels. Monitoring these factors can help assess future market dynamics.
